  • Fraternity Sues Members Over Hazing Incident

    01:14|
    Alpha Sigma Phi Fraternity Faces Lawsuit Over Hazing Incident at Rutgers University A national fraternity, Alpha Sigma Phi, is planning to sue its former members at Rutgers University following a severe hazing incident last fall. The incident resulted in a nineteen-year-old student from Matawan being critically injured at the Alpha Sigma Phi house in New Brunswick. The fraternity claims the hazing occurred in the basement with underground new members, involving water. The fraternity has closed the chapter, evicted the students, and Rutgers has put them on probation until May eighteenth with a cease and desist order. The Middlesex County Prosecutors Office is still investigating the incident, with no charges filed yet. The house also has a history of code violations, including electrical hazards.   • Latino Superintendent Honored in NJ

    01:37|
    Raymond González, Westfields Latino superintendent, is New Jerseys top educator for 2026. After nearly three decades in education, he was honored in Trenton by the New Jersey Association of School Administrators. González, who started as a bilingual teacher, is praised for his deep roots in family, community, and service. Hes leading Westfield Public Schools, overseeing ten schools and nearly six thousand students. His leadership is hailed as a game-changer for equity and excellence in New Jersey schools.   • Bagel Bazaar Expands with Franchise Model

    01:38|
    Bagel Bazaar, a New Jersey bagel chain since 1987, is expanding with a franchise model. Owner Paul Salas, who started as a teen employee, plans to focus franchising in New Jersey and Pennsylvania. The company, known for its New York-style bagels and loaded sandwiches, produces ten million bagels annually and ships nationwide. They aim to have fifty franchises by 2030 and 250 units by 2040.
